Summary Information

  • Ownership: Takreer (Abu Dhabi National Oil Company)
  • Website: http://www.takreer.com/
  • Location: Ruwais, Abu Dhabi
  • Capacity: 20 million tons/annum & 400,000 bbl/day
  • Nelson Complexity:
  • Project Stage: Tendering (March 2010)
  • Expected Completion: 2014
  • Budget: $10 Billion

The Project

  • Project Type: Expansion / Upgrade
  • Project Summary: The company will raise its refining capacity at the site by 400,000 barrels a day (b/d), by constructing the new refinery to operate alongside the existing 417,000-b/d facility.
  • Main Contractors: Axens, Shaw, GS Engineering and Construction, Samsung Engineering Co. Ltd., Daewoo Engineering '&' Construction
  • The new facility will utilize a wide range of UOP technologies for the production of clean, low sulfur distillate and gasoline.

Refining Units

  • Unsaturated LPG treatment unit – 59,800 bbl/day
  • C4-cut purification system – 37,800 bbl/day
  • Residue fluid catalytic cracker (RFCC) - 127,100 bbl/day
  • Butane Isomerization unit – 26,000 bbl/day
  • Naphtha hydrotreater – 40,930 bbl/day
  • Delayed Coker
  • Slurry Hydro-desulphurization Unit
  • Carbon Black Unit
  • Distillate Hydro Treating Unit
  • Propane Dehydrogenation Unit
  • Coke calcification Unit

Products Produced

  • The refinery will produce propylene, unleaded gasoline, naphtha, liquefied petroleum gas (LPG), aviation turbine fuel, kerosene, gas-oil & bunker fuel

History

  • 2011 - Front End Engineering and Design (FEED) and license packages for Carbon Black & Delayed Coker Awarded
